More iOS 6 Development: Further Explorations of the iOS SDK by Jeff LaMarche, David Mark, Alex Horovitz, Kevin Kim

By Jeff LaMarche, David Mark, Alex Horovitz, Kevin Kim

Interested in iPhone and iPad apps improvement? are looking to study extra? no matter if you’re a self-taught iPhone and iPad apps development genius or have simply made your means throughout the pages of Beginning iOS 6 Development, now we have the ideal publication for you.

More iOS 6 improvement: additional Explorations of the iOS SDK digs deeper into Apple’s most recent iOS 6 SDK. Bestselling authors Dave Mark, Alex Horovitz, Kevin Kim and Jeff LaMarche clarify techniques as in simple terms they can—covering themes like middle facts, peer-to-peer networking utilizing GameKit and community streams, operating with facts from the net, MapKit, in-application e mail, and extra. all of the thoughts and APIs are in actual fact offered with code snippets you could customise and use, as you're keen on, on your personal apps.

while you are going to write down a qualified iPhone or iPad app, you’ll are looking to get your fingers round middle facts, and there’s no larger position to take action than within the pages of this e-book. The e-book maintains correct the place Beginning iOS 6 Development leaves off, with a sequence of chapters dedicated to center info, the normal for Apple persistence. Dave, Alex, Kevin and Jeff carefully step via every one middle facts suggestion and convey recommendations and information in particular for writing better apps—offering a breadth of insurance you won't locate wherever else.

The center information assurance by myself is well worth the expense of admission. yet there's a lot more! More iOS 6 improvement covers numerous networking mechanisms, from GameKit’s fairly uncomplicated BlueTooth peer-to-peer version, to the addition of Bonjour discovery and community streams, in the course of the complexity of having access to documents through the net.

Dave, Alex, Kevin, and Jeff also will take you thru assurance of concurrent programming and a few complex innovations for debugging your functions. the improved multitasking, threading, reminiscence administration and extra are important. Apps have become an increasing number of complicated, together with subtle online game apps that provide digital or augmented truth reviews and new mapping perspectives that make the most of sensors and different APIs within the latest iOS 6 SDK.

Whether you're a relative newcomer to iPhone and iPad or iOS development or an previous hand trying to extend your horizons, there’s whatever for everybody in More iOS 6 Development.

Show description

Read or Download More iOS 6 Development: Further Explorations of the iOS SDK PDF

Similar development books

Build Your Own Website The Right Way Using HTML & CSS (3rd Edition)

With over 60,000 copies offered on account that its first variation, this SitePoint best-seller has simply had a clean replace to incorporate contemporary advances within the internet industry.

With the 1st versions coming hugely advised by way of confirmed, prime internet designers and builders, the 3rd variation with all its additional candies will proceed that pattern. additionally totally up to date to incorporate the most recent working platforms, net browsers and delivering fixes to matters that experience cropped up because the final edition.

Readers will study to:
* type textual content and keep an eye on your web page structure with CSS
* Create and Optimize pix for the net
* upload interactivity on your websites with varieties
* contain a customized seek, touch us web page, and a News/Events part in your web site
* song viewers with Google Analytics
* expand your achieve and fasten your web site with Social Media
* Use HTML5&CSS3 so as to add a few cool, polished beneficial properties in your website
* Use diagnosis/debug instruments to discover any difficulties
and many extra.

China’s Grain for Green Program: A Review of the Largest Ecological Restoration and Rural Development Program in the World

This publication presents a complete evaluate of Grain for eco-friendly, China’s national application which will pay farmers to revert sloping or marginal farm land to bushes or grass. this system goals to enhance the ecological stipulations of a lot of China, and the socioeconomic conditions of hundreds and hundreds of thousands of individuals.

Teaching and Learning in Lower Secondary Schools in the Era of PISA and TIMSS

This booklet explores instructing and studying in decrease secondary school rooms within the 3 PISA domain names technology, arithmetic and examining. in line with broad video documentation from technology, math and analyzing study rooms in Norwegian secondary education, it analyzes how provided and skilled educating and studying possibilities in those 3 topic parts help scholars’ studying.

Extra info for More iOS 6 Development: Further Explorations of the iOS SDK

Sample text

Xcdatamodel to bring up Xcode's model editor. Make sure the Utility pane is visible (it should be the third button on the View bar), and select the Inspector. Your Xcode window should look like Figure 2-8. CHAPl'ER 2: Core Data: What, Why, and How 14 .. ;u ... ,.. UII .. u~ ~ .. -- ....... Cl r ... ~f\»otnJ~-f DlI .. , • - ..... c. -.... I - • 0 .... fwll o. o. '!.! :TlrjlttDlbilt; __ ' ObiKlr--C tal ( . 0 . ustwti. '-K"~CaM TOld. Figure 2-8. xcdatamodel, the Editor pane changed to present the Core Data model editor (Figure 2-9).

You used to need to do all this work yourself. Now you can ask your fetched results controller to do all the data management for you. It's an amazing time-saver! Let's take a closer look at the creation of the fetched results controller. m, use the function menu to go to the method -fetchedResultsController. = nil) { return _fetchedResultsController; } 30 CHAPTER 2: Core Data: What, Why, and How NSFetchRequest *fetchRequest = [[NSFetchRequest alloc] init]; II Edit the entity name as appropriate.

That said, Core Data does support the use of multiple persistent stores. You could, for example, design your application to store some of its data in a SQLite persistent store and some of it in a binary flat file. If you find that you need to use multiple data models, remember to change the template code here to load the managed object models individually using mergedModelFromBundles:. The Persistent Store and Persistent Store Coordinator The persistent store, which is sometimes referred to as a backing store, is where Core Data stores its data.

Download PDF sample

Rated 4.84 of 5 – based on 41 votes